Phuket Veggies and Blood Attract More Tourists from China

PHUKET: More Chinese than ever before are on Phuket this year for the Vegetarian Festival, says regional Tourism Authority of Thailand director Bangornrat Shinaprayoon.

Most of the activities - the vegetarian food stalls and daily parades - centre on Phuket City where hotels report occupancy between 80 and 90 percent.

The festival has consistently attracted visitors from Singapore and Malaysia but numbers from China are likely to continue to increase as people learn that Phuket still upholds traditions that were suppressed by the Communists.

Today's parade from the Samkong Shrine began in perfect conditions with larger-than-normal numbers of onlookers lining the route. The choice of decorations by entranced warriors was less confronting than those from Sapham Temple the previous day, when one mah song had to be taken to hospital after losing too much blood.

But more prevalent during today's parade - and considered too bloody to be published in Phuketwan were warriors using axes and hatchets to slash their tongues, and penitents lashing their backs to draw blood.
